Creative PSAs To Help Poor

Walkerville Collegiate Institute in Windsor will soon be creating public service announcements to get more youth involved at the Downtown Mission.

The Ontario Ministry of Education is providing funding for 25 students to participate in a program called ICE, which stands for Innovation, Creativity and Entrepreneurship.

Mission Director Ron Dunn is excited about the project. "We're assisting many young people at the mission, from a poverty perspective. So for youth that are not experiencing poverty to come in and help other youth -- we think it's going to go a long way."

Dunn has yet to nail down exactly where the PSAs will be aired, but says Cogeco is one likely destination.
